When Do You Practice?
All the time and everywhere. Not really, but you could. I usually have a few chips near my computer, in the living room, and at work. If I’m playing poker online, I’ll mess around with the chips in between hands just as if I was playing at a real table. When I’m watching TV or a movie at home, I’ll practice tricks that I don’t need to look at to do. Actually when you get good enough you shouldn’t need to look at any of them. Since I answer phones at work a lot of the time, it’s also a good time to practice. Although I don’t recommend it, sometimes I do poker chip tricks in the car too. Dropping them sucks though because they always find their way under the seat or down by the pedals.
Basically you can practice anywhere it’s convenient for you. Make sure to think about the people around you though. Some of the tricks can make a lot of noise, especially when you repeatedly drop the chips on a hard surface.
